Officials: 'We Can't Delay' New Hudson Tunnel

U.S. Transportation Secretary Anthony Foxx met with New Jersey Gov. Chris Christie and U.S. Senators Cory Booker and Robert Menendez to discuss building a new Hudson River rail tunnel. The meeting comes as the deterioration of Amtrak's current tunnel is causing a new sense of urgency, and the officials issued a joint statement saying "we cannot afford further delay." The politicians also pledged to work together to obtain a "substantial" federal grant and other financing for the project.

After the meeting, the officials dodged reporters gathered in the lobby, and Christie slipped out the back door. Asked how important this is, he said, "I showed up today, right?"

New York Gov. Andrew Governor Cuomo did not.

His office said the focus of the meeting was on New Jersey transportation issues, though Foxx had issued an invitation to both governors to come to the table back in July. Cuomo issued a statement of his own instead, saying the parties seem to be on the same page. "I strongly support the construction of the new Hudson River tunnel, and a federal grant package that makes the project viable is an essential first step," he said.
